Donatello was having the time of his life, and he was nothing but smiles as he had been engaged in this battle. Leonardo, Raphael and Michelangelo were watching with cautious optimism as Donatello pushed himself upwards only to throw his body weight upward and firmly planted his hands onto the mat and set himself back onto his feet, quickly evading the massive steel ball which Chang tried to slam down onto the Turtle. Donatello just looked upon the larger opponent as Chang now once more stepped forward, lumbering for another attack as he raised his right arm only to bring it down and aim to crash it down onto the red masked reptile. The mutant Turtle side-stepped from the incoming path of the ball, and went onto the offensive now.

Swiftly, Donatello thrust his staff forward and butted the blunt end of the weapon firmly into Chang’s gut. Upon contact, the staff would emit a quick conduit of electricity and sparks erupted as the staff managed land it’s mark. Chang lurched forward, his hands losing their hold onto the steel ball, dropping it onto his right foot.

“HOOOOOH HOOOH HOOOH!!”

Chang moved his hands down and took hold of the heavy ball, pushing it off from his foot. Quickly raising his foot and gripping it within his hands, he worked to massage and undo the discomfort and pain which he was most unfortunate in experiencing. The burly man hadn’t even so much as realized that he had left himself completely wide open for attack. Taking advantage of this, Donatello quickly planted his staff onto the arena mat and catapulted himself forward, now pushing himself ahead and he snapped his right leg out, impacting Chang firmly in his mid-section, causing the large felon to stumble back and again place his hands onto his stomach.

Choi released a sigh as he shook his head from side to side, clearly disapproving of how Chang Koehan was performing at this particular round. Kim sternly stared ahead, crossing his arms as he took the time to observe how his disciple was being so particularly sloppy. Already, he was thinking of ways of making Chang’s training regimen more grueling as a means of punishment.

“He hasn’t learned a thing with the training… Unacceptable!”

“Well what do you expect from the big lummox?” Choi responded.

Anger now began to swell within Chang, and he rushed forward and aimed to ram right in towards the Turtle as he leaned forward with his left shoulder out. But Donatello had been counting on this, and he side-stepped to the right and turned in a quick spin to maneuver himself behind the Korean. In the midst of his spin, he hunched down and moved his arms, swinging his staff for the large man’s ankles. Chang frantically flailed his arms and he hit the ground flat onto his face and gullet. Quickly capitalizing on his downed opponent, Donatello spun his staff in a figure eight motion before he would turn with his hips and swung the ends horizontally from right to left, striking away at Chang’s shoulders, arms and sides.

The felon worked to push through the beating which Donatello happened to be inflicting on him, gritting his teeth in a display of resistance and anger. In a haze of fury, Chang moved his arms out and took hold of the red masked reptile, and quickly stood to his feet only to now throw his arms forward and release his grasp from his smaller opponent, tossing him across the ring. Donatello widened his eyes from the sudden sensation of weightless, feeling himself now suddenly being rebounded by the ropes and catapulted right back at the bearded man. Chang quickly came rushing in, moving his left arm across for a clothesline. With his quick thinking kicking to play, Donatello leaned forward and threw his weight forward, rolling underneath the incoming arm. Immediately, he snapped his right leg back and out as he took aim for Chang’s back. Impact was made, and the large bearded man was forced to stumble forward and he moved his arms to grab hold of something. He gripped the ropes, but the sudden movement made his footing give, and he flipped head over heels and hit the ground feet first, dropping to his knees and suddenly collapsing onto his stomach and face once again.

“You’re doing great, Donnie! Keep it up!” Leonardo hollered, cupping his hands around his beak.

However, things weren’t looking so good for the opposing team. Jhun moved a hand up, closing his eyes as he pinched the bridge of his nose as he shook his head from side to side in disapproval of the sad display which Chang was putting on. He couldn’t help but ponder that maybe he should’ve gone first. Choi on the other hand,  threw his hands up and released an exasperated and embarrassed sigh. He shouted for Chang.

“Get up, you galoot! You’re going to let some punk in a frog costume catch you with your pants down?!”

Infuriated even further, Chang slammed his fist onto the floor and bolted to stand. He turned and unleashed a furious roar at the red masked Turtle as he gripped the ropes and climbed back into the ring. Upon doing so, Chang again ran right for Donatello and he kicked his right leg out to meet the Turtle’s chest. Like before, Donatello side-stepped out of the way of the incoming kick, moving to the left rather swiftly. Chang turned and quickly reached out for his ball and chain. Grabbing the weapon, he didn’t hesitate as he now would swing the heavy ball by the chain, and swung it across with the intent to hit Donatello and perhaps smash his shell open with it.

“WHOAH!” Donatello hunched as the ball came right in for him, thankfully moving overhead.

Chang roared in fury as he now swung the ball across in the opposite direction from before, still intending on crushing the Turtle with the heavy ball and chain. The brainy Turtle widened his eyes and he again hunched down underneath the felon’s weapon. Chang quickly raised his weapon, and aimed to swing it down on top of the mutant Red Ear Slider. Without even thinking about his next move, Donatello jumped to the side and rushed in while feeling the ring shake from the weight of the ball being dropped.

Donatello rushed in towards the large bearded man before Chang could pull up the ball with his hand. Quickly, the red masked Turtle firmly planted his staff onto the mat and he kicked himself up, throwing his weight across to the left and kicked both feet out, firmly slamming them into the larger opponent’s gullet. Chang wheezed out in immediate discomfort and he stumbled back against the ropes, his weight threatening to send him toppling over once more, but he fought to regain his footing. The red masked brainy reptile moved his arms, bringing the ends of his staff horizontally across for Chang’s sides, and he would firmly strike at his opponent as audible smacks were heard. Chang grunted out and winced as he would be feeling the pile up from how hard Donatello was striking him with the staff, and then he suddenly felt a tremendous shock coursing through as the Turtle again thrust that staff outward, striking him with the blunt end of the weapon and causing a flow of electricity to move into him.

Donatello turned in a spin, and he swung his staff across horizontally to the left, firmly striking Chang on the back and causing the large man to stumble forward.

Jhun, Choi and Kim shook their heads as they stared down in disapproval of Chang’s performance in this battle. They hadn’t anticipated that what could be their team’s first defeat would be something so humiliatingly bad. If they hadn’t known any better, it was as if the opposition was playing with them. Kim looked up, and continued to watch and realized… that Donatello wasn’t playing, but rather fighting quite smart.

That was something which he had to commend.

Leonardo crossed his arms, nodding his head in approval of Donatello’s dominance in this match. But then what had he expected from his intellectual brother? It seemed as if his draw with Andy Bogard lit a fire in him, and he definitely seemed to show some enthusiasm about wanting to make up for the previous match. Michelangelo and Raphael were cheering for Donatello with much fervor.

 Chang grit his teeth, defiantly trying to find whatever strength which he could as he now swung his ball across as he gripped it firmly in his hands, intending to strike at Donatello, but the brainy Turtle hunched down and managed to evade the weapon rather quickly. Taking sights of Chang’s legs, Donatello quickly swung both ends of his staff across, smacking Chang directly in his knees, and then thrust his staff forward, then dragged it back. This caused Chang to lose his footing once more and forced him to split his legs apart, his weight dropping down the middle.

“HOOOOOO HOOOO HOOOOOOOO!!” Chang cried out in pain, as his inner thigh muscles were stretched. He could only describe it as a sharp agony moving down to his knees now effectively removing his ability to stand.

Both the Turtles and Team Korea cringed at the sight of the large man positioned like that.

Chang just dropped to his sides, clutching at his legs as he shut his eyes in pain and shouted, announcing his defeat. Donatello meanwhile turned as he spun his staff within his right hand, and tucked it underneath his right arm with a satisfied smile on his face as he moved his way back over to his brothers.

The match was decided.

“Great job Donnie. You made up for the last match!” Raphael grinned.

“Glad to have your seal of approval, oh brother of mine!” Don chuckled.

Leonardo took the time to stare across the arena, observing the opposing team now huddling as they were getting ready to discuss on who they might be sending out to participate in the next match.

Kim Kaphwan stared to his remaining active members as he had moved his arms out, placing them around Choi and Jhun’s shoulders. Chang’s defeat was something that perhaps could have been prevented had the larger man trained harder and more diligently, rather than fight with his brute strength. That was something which the Taekwondo master was going to have to correct at a later time. But right now, Team Korea only had three chances remaining.

“Alright, Chang’s out… I don’t think he can stand. He might have pulled a hamstring or two.” Jhun spoke.

“Well, that frog made him split like that… I mean looking at that just hurts. I don’t think having kids is possible for him now. Just what kind of fighting is that anyway? He couldn’t even get a hit in.” Choi growled.

“A loss is a loss. I’ll correct Chang’s approach whenever we get back to training. But right now we need to figure out who we’re going to send out there. That team proved their worth when they won against Terry and his friends.” Kim spoke, raising his eyes to gaze upon the Turtles only to be met by Leonardo’s own stare.

“I’ll go. The big guy took one for the team, so it only makes sense that I go, eh?” Choi spoke out.

“By all means.” Kim nodded.

Leonardo watched as Choi now climbed up onto the ropes and slipped between them. The opposing team had chosen their next fighter, so now it was up to them to send out the next member on their team.

“Hey man, I gotta make up for my loss against the Kunoichi girl from the last fight!” Michelangelo spoke.

Leonardo turned to face his younger brother, arms still crossed as he blinked in surprise. It seemed as if other than just himself and Donatello who felt like that they needed to make up for their own shortcomings, Michelangelo was also feeling the same as well. Hopefully, his younger sibling realized the level of competition which they were facing.

“I promise… I’ll do better!” Mike smiled softly.

“We’re gonna hold you to it, bright boy! So you get on in there and kick some serious ass! Don’t let no Freddy Krueger wannabe catch you sleeping!” Raphael gruffly addressed his brother.

Michelangelo chuckled as he now stepped over towards the ring, now moving his hands up and took hold of the ropes. He pushed himself to a leap, then threw his weight forward and down, flipping over the ropes and soon found himself padding his feet onto the ring mat. As he entered, the wily Turtle looked over to see two of the tournament staff helping the larger bearded Korean man to his feet, and were heaving him away as he seemed to have a hard time standing and could only manage small limps. Mikey couldn’t help but cringe at that.

“Damn, Don… I gotta say that was kind of mean, even for you.”

Michelangelo and Choi now stared to one another, and the wily Turtle noted the many blades which were on the smaller Korean’s fingers. He couldn’t help but blink at this and also took notice of the fedora hat. No wonder Raphael had referred to him as a Freddy Krueger wannabe.

“So who came up with your look? You takin’ pages from Robert Englund’s filmography or something?”

“You stupid frog! I’ll have you know that my look is unique!” Choi interjected as he flicked his hands, spreading the steel claws open in an attempt to intimidate the Turtle.

Michelangelo moved his hands to his utility belt and gripped his chained nunchaku within his hands. Upon drawing them out, he spun and twirled them to display his level of skill with the weapons. He would move them in a figure eight motion, exchanging the handles between his fingers, and then swung them upwards and down—tucking them underneath his arms as he turned with his right side facing Choi Bounge.

“Man, you come right out of a comic book! It’s on like Donkey Kong!” He chuckled.

And then the bell rang.

Michelangelo and Choi took a few seconds to size each other up. When they were confident in themselves, the two rushed towards another. Blades were slashed. Nunchaku were swung.

Only one could walk away from this match.
